Meet the budding wedding fashion house that makes dreams come true for grooms and stylish men. KochHouse is a black-owned, Nigerian-owned business that focuses on fusing royal elements such as handmade embroidery designs and conventional costume styling patterns. This year, an authentic mix of culture and originality will be highlighted at both the National Wedding Show and the Modern African wedding show, both in the UK.
KochHouse is a well-known African brand and is known for its unique pieces. Part of their elite client base includes celebrities, brands and collaborations.

KochHouse pieces are made exclusively for men with unique cuts and handmade embellishments of African roots and elements. These pieces will definitely make you stand out at any red carpet look or event.

“Royalty runs deep in our veins.”
These pieces reflect the true story and culture of prosperous Africa. Africa, as it is seen in the media, is known for its struggle and its lack. But creative director of KochHouse – Nkwocha Nonye, believes that Black is not synonymous with lack and is therefore inspired to show the deeply rich, luxurious side of the continent. “We are not all kings and princes, but we come from a royal line”
The diversity in colors and languages opens the continent to a multitude of possibilities that can translate into inspiration, creating limitless designs and possibilities that have not yet been tapped.
They hope to show this to the world in various ways, hoping to re-educate the rest of the world about the sophistication and opulence that lies within.
